
https://nextdns.io/?from=c9w9rzh7
The Domain Name System (DNS) is fundamentally a system that translates domain names into IP addresses, allowing browsers to load Internet resources. Beyond its primary function, DNS can play a crucial role in defending against malware and other cyber threats in several ways:
DNS Filtering
DNS filtering involves blocking requests to known malicious domains. When a user attempts to access a website, the DNS query is checked against a database of domain names associated with malware, phishing, and other malicious activities. If the domain is on the list, the DNS query can be blocked, preventing the user from reaching the harmful site.
DNS Firewall
A DNS firewall works similarly to DNS filtering but is more sophisticated. It can block malicious traffic and also prevent exfiltration of data to command-and-control servers operated by attackers. By monitoring DNS requests, a DNS firewall can identify and block traffic to and from known malicious IP addresses, domains, and even detect unusual patterns that may indicate a compromised system within the network.
DNSSEC (Domain Name System Security Extensions)
DNSSEC adds a layer of security to the DNS lookup and response process by ensuring that the information provided by the DNS server is authenticated and hasnโt been tampered with. This is crucial because it helps prevent man-in-the-middle attacks where an attacker could intercept and alter DNS data to redirect users to malicious sites without their knowledge.
Threat Intelligence and Analysis
By analyzing DNS query data, organizations can identify patterns indicative of malware infections, such as frequent requests to domains known for hosting malware or command-and-control servers. This analysis can help in early detection of security incidents, allowing for quicker response and mitigation.
Zero Trust Security
DNS can be integrated into a zero-trust security framework by ensuring that all DNS requests, regardless of origin or destination, are authenticated, authorized, and encrypted. This approach minimizes the risk of DNS-based attacks and reduces the attack surface.
Malware Distribution Prevention
DNS can be used to prevent the distribution of malware by blocking access to domains known to distribute malicious software. This includes blocking downloads from suspicious sites or sites that are known to host malware.
Implementing Secure DNS Practices
Organizations can implement secure DNS practices by using DNS providers that offer enhanced security features, such as encryption (DNS over HTTPS or DNS over TLS), DNSSEC, and advanced threat intelligence. These measures significantly reduce the risk of DNS spoofing, poisoning, and other DNS-based attacks.
In summary, by leveraging DNS filtering, DNS firewalls, DNSSEC, and integrating DNS into broader cybersecurity practices and threat intelligence, organizations can effectively defend against malware, phishing, and a wide array of cyber threats.
